Benefits of Enhanced Airflow and Cooling Efficiency with Performance Intercoolers

Performance intercoolers significantly enhance airflow in vehicles. These systems allow cooler air to enter the engine, improving combustion. Cooler air is denser, which means more oxygen. More oxygen translates to better engine performance and increased power output.

In many cars, factory intercoolers may not be efficient enough. This can lead to higher intake temperatures. When temperatures rise, engine performance can suffer. Some drivers notice reduced acceleration and sluggish responses. Investing in a performance intercooler can alleviate these issues, providing a robust solution for improved cooling efficiency.

Enhanced airflow also plays a role in engine longevity. With better temperature regulation, engine components face less stress. This may reduce wear and tear over time. It’s not just about power; it’s about sustaining performance. However, it’s essential to ensure that the installation is done correctly. Poor installation can counteract benefits, leading to more problems down the road. There’s much to consider before upgrading; careful planning is key.

Impact of Performance Intercoolers on Engine Horsepower and Torque Gains

Performance intercoolers play a crucial role in boosting engine horsepower and torque. A high-quality intercooler can lower intake air temperatures significantly. This cooling effect allows the engine to draw in denser air, leading to more oxygen for combustion. A study published by the Journal of Automotive Engineering shows that effective intercooling can result in horsepower gains of 10-20%.

Installing a Custom Performance Intercooler can enhance your vehicle’s overall efficiency. With lower intake temperatures, engines can operate at higher boost levels without risking knock. This improvement typically translates to a torque increase of around 15-25%, depending on the vehicle setup. It’s interesting to note that some performance enthusiasts report even higher gains when optimized tuning is also applied.

However, integrating a performance intercooler is not without challenges. Fitment issues can arise, particularly in tightly packed engine bays. Additionally, potential changes in air-fuel ratios might necessitate further tuning. It’s important to constantly evaluate the system for leaks and performance issues after installation. Although gains can be significant, the real-world results may vary based on individual driving conditions and tuning approaches.

Reduction of Turbo Lag through Optimized Heat Exchange Mechanisms

Turbo lag can be a frustrating issue for many car enthusiasts. A performance intercooler addresses this problem effectively. By optimizing heat exchange mechanisms, it allows cooler air intake. Cooler air means denser air, leading to more efficient combustion. As a result, turbo lag is significantly reduced. Drivers can notice faster acceleration and improved throttle response.

When the intercooler works efficiently, it helps maintain optimal temperatures. Heat buildup can negatively impact performance. An effective intercooler can prevent this. However, it's important to choose the right intercooler design for your setup. Not all vehicles will benefit equally. There may be a learning curve to find the best fit.

Installation is another area that might need some care. DIY enthusiasts might attempt to install it themselves, but it's not always straightforward. Misalignments or improper fittings can lead to leaks. Regular checks after installation are essential for performance. Finding the right balance is crucial for reducing turbo lag. Making well-informed choices can enhance your driving experience.

Comparative Analysis: Factory Intercoolers vs. Performance Intercoolers

Top 10 Benefits of a Performance Intercooler for Your Car?

When comparing factory intercoolers to performance intercoolers, several key differences emerge. Factory intercoolers typically prioritize cost-effectiveness and basic functionality. They may not provide substantial cooling, often allowing intake temperatures to rise during aggressive driving. Conversely, performance intercoolers are engineered for higher efficiency and airflow. Reports indicate that vehicles equipped with performance intercoolers can achieve up to 30% lower intake temperatures, resulting in more horsepower.

Choosing a performance intercooler allows for enhanced vehicle responsiveness. Enhanced cooling means better air density and combustion efficiency. Some Performance Intercooler Manufacturers claim gains of up to 20-40 horsepower in turbocharged setups. However, installation can be complex for certain models. Also, not all designs offer the same airflow benefits and durability.

Tips: Always scrutinize performance specs when selecting an intercooler. Look for materials that ensure longevity. Installation guidelines should also be reviewed thoroughly. Remember, not every upgrade is necessary. Weigh the cost against expected performance outcomes to make informed decisions.
